Job description

We’re seeking an outstanding Senior HTOL Reliability Engineer to join our Santa Clara lab. This role requires deep device-circuitry knowledge and hands-on hardware development. You will build next-generation HTOL boards and run HTOL processes on advanced ovens. This ensures world-class reliability of the silicon powering the AI era.

What you’ll be doing:

  • Implement and optimize HTOL test programs aligned with JEDEC standards.
  • Operate and maintain HTOL ovens, ensuring efficient test conditions and high data accuracy.
  • Design, debug, and bring up HTOL burn in boards. Debug and bring up HTOL patterns.
  • Apply sophisticated thermal management techniques to deliver detailed temperature control and mitigate thermal stress in HTOL environments.
  • Work alongside lab technicians and reliability engineers to solve technical challenges and continuously improving test processes.
  • Contribute to cross-functional teams to debug and resolve hardware and software product issues in the HTOL environment.
  • Maintain and improve our reliability database, finding opportunities for improvement.
  • Collaborate with vendors to develop and implement improvements to burn-in boards, HTOL systems, and thermal interface materials.

Requirements

  • Master’s or Bachelor’s degree in Electrical Engineering or a related field (or equivalent experience).
  • 5+ years of experience in HTOL test system operation and data analysis for semiconductor devices.
  • Proven expertise in HTOL stress testing, JEDEC standards, and environmental stress tests, including Temperature Cycling (TC), Reflow, Thermal Shock, and HAST.
  • Strong ATE or TE skills, including pattern bring up and pcb board debugging and design.
  • Hands-on experience with High power HTOL chambers including operation, repair, and preventative maintenance of HTOL chamber.
  • Proficiency with oscilloscopes, current probes, and other test equipment for data acquisition and analysis.
  • Experience with pattern vector debugging, test script development/modification, and data analysis tools.
  • Programming experience with Python or MATLAB for data analysis and automation.
  • Excellent communication, teamwork, and problem solving skills, with strong attention to detail.

Ways to stand out from the crowd:

  • Experience with multi-die HTOL testing and the associated testing challenges.
  • Background in HTOL board design for high power GPU or SoC devices.
  • Pattern translations, debugging, bringup, experience working with DFT.
  • Familiarity with reliability analytics platforms (e.g., JMP) and statistical lifetime modeling (e.g., Weibull, Arrhenius).
  • Track record of driving vendor qualification and component selection for reliability test hardware.
